What is Bench Talkies (2015) about?

Bench Talkies (2015) is an anthology film featuring six short films crafted by six different directors, each exploring unique stories and themes. The anthology captures slices of urban life, blending drama, comedy, and action into a compact yet diverse cinematic experience.

Who directed Bench Talkies?

The anthology is helmed by Karthik Subbaraj, who is joined by five aspiring filmmakers. This collaborative approach highlights both his vision and the raw creativity of emerging talents.

Who stars in Bench Talkies?

The anthology features Guru Somasundaram, Aravind, Nisha Krishnan, Anukush Agarwal, Sandeep Menon, and Sharathkumar in key roles across its six short films.

Bench Talkies: A 2015 Anthology of Short Films by Karthik Subbaraj — Full Movie Info

Bench Talkies (2015) is a fascinating anthology that brings together six micro-films helmed by both established and emerging voices, with Karthik Subbaraj anchoring the project as the most recognizable talent behind the camera. Each short film explores distinct themes and moods—from raw, urban struggles to quirky comedic twists—showcasing a dynamic range of storytelling styles within a single unifying concept. The anthology pulses with an urban energy, blending humor, drama, and action into bite-sized narratives that feel both intimate and expansive.

This experimental collection feels less like a traditional movie and more like a cinematic sampler, offering viewers a chance to dip into short, punchy stories that linger long after the credits roll. The diverse genres and tones reflect the creative risk-taking of six different directors, each lending their unique perspective to this ambitious project.
